Hi Weiqiang,

 

This tpms is without sensors in tyres to be installed and no batteries to change or sensors without replaceable batteristo be thrown. Pls google indirect tpms and it had been around for years ...uses rotation of wheels to calculate if one of the tyres is significantly smaller in diameter to alert you on flats. To recalibrate after rotation or tyre change, you press a button and run it for 1km. Disadvantage is that you do not see absolute pressure to optimise it but you circumvent by pumping say every 1-2 mths. Installation is just plug and olay into obd socket.

Hi John,

 

1. Indeed normal. Guess you had also noticed our dusty front rims and it is quite usual of conti car to have more abrupt/less progressive braking, high dusty and this noise. If you wish, you can change to vetto, nibk, asuki etc. brake pad and it is be less dusty, noise and back to progressive feel of typical jap cars but arguably less braking performance.

 

2. These reverse and front sensors are local tiong fitting and low end IR technology ... always problematic with false alarm, failed sensors, prone to water leakage and greatly affected rain. Yes ..it is also normal and depending on design, drilling a small hole at sensors allow water to drain out help in some case.

 

3. This rattling is common and can be due to several reasons ...3d party wiring not insulated e.g. gps, stick connector, warp of glove compartment and enclosure etc. Pls go to aestmod at 23 Geylang Lorong 11 to find ah boon for help.
